The 1.3 multiplier comes from having the full Cygni set -- it's completely unrelated to the STK itself. The 1.3 multiplier ONLY applies to the way the damage works on the full Cygni armour. The armour bonus description reads that "RPG damage is boosted by 30%". It's the same story for the Atom Armour and beam weapons. The calculation you just did assumes that the STK multiplies the power bonuses from your armour pieces - sadly, that isn't the case. If you're not quite sure about that, go to the store menu with your hybrid armour, and put the Black Stars on your character. Check what the power number reads, and figure out the calculations for it. Then change your "store" armour to all Cygni pieces (i.e. make it look like you want to buy the whole Cygni set). Check the number, and do the calculations - last I recall, it should be the way I just described it above.

Hey DBC...apparently, you CAN take a glitched Nova into boss runs o__O To do so, go start or join a PvP match. You can leave immediately afterwards if you'd like, you just need to have been in it to trigger the glitch. Now, without terminating the game from the taskbar (preferably without logging out from online mode), go start or join a boss room, and *listen* to what happens when you fire your Nova... Note that the glitch undoes itself after playing in a boss room, so if you want to trigger it again, you need to join and leave/finish a PvP match again. But yeah, you should find that gun SIGNIFICANTLY more powerful with its glitched rate of fire --------------------- If you have no qualms about using this technique, then you've just obtained a mini Laser Cannon without the charge-up time, overheating and speed penalty. Ammo cost is roughly the same as the Crab when fired over the same period of time, but damage is NOTICEABLY stronger. Enjoy
